Case Number: 6318
Jones, Sam - Age 36 - Colored - Shot to death at 11:35 P.M. at his home, 64 E. Austin Ave., a rooming house owned by Georgia Spotsville, who shot intending to hit another man. On 11/12/24 she was held by the Coroner for manslaughter. 28 Dist. 3/21/25 - Acquitted - Lynch.
